Find the value of c such that the expression is a perfect square trinomial
Alika [10]

Answer:

c = 4

Step-by-step explanation:

In a perfect square trinomial, the following relationship is true:

(x+y)^2=x^2+2xy+y^2

In order for the given expression to be a perfect square trinomial:

x^2=x^2\\4x=2xy\\c=y^2

Solving for 'c':

4x=2xy\\y=2\\c=y^2=2^2\\c=4

Therefore, c must be equal to 4.
